Keyword Research competitor

Reverse-engineers competitor keyword strategies for a specific product or service, identifies ranking gaps across four stages, and delivers a prioritized top-20 target list with composite scoring. Use when you need a structured competitive keyword gap analysis tied to a concrete action plan.

Quality checks

  • The gap analysis distinguishes between 'not ranking at all', 'ranking 11–30', and 'ranking but low CTR' categories — these require different actions and should not be lumped together.
  • The top 20 priority keywords table includes volume, difficulty, intent, and a composite priority score — not just a ranked list by volume.
  • Every volume and difficulty figure is either sourced from supplied data or explicitly labeled as an estimate, so the user knows what to verify.
